Output cd86c2eb623eec2a2dcb42b0450f458139da672020a29601a90ffeb12d4f578d:5

value
480549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3820f511ddf6876e164ce80789d96ee8666094 OP_EQUAL
address
32zCd84a5XwqpyQv7Vg3drWfCznaHaVzhD
transaction
cd86c2eb623eec2a2dcb42b0450f458139da672020a29601a90ffeb12d4f578d
confirmations
171038
spent
true